### Changelog — Pointsmith ledger, defaults changed

This release changes default settings for the Pointsmith loyalty ledger. Accrual batching is now enabled by default, and the reconciliation window shrank from daily to hourly to reduce stale balances. Reviewers should confirm downstream jobs tolerate the shorter window. The new default configuration shipped with this release is listed below.

settings of tagef-bawif:
DRUIX_HOST=druix.zemvarlabs.internal
DRUIX_PORT=8000

Q3 Planning Note — New Subscription Tier

Quick update for the board: the "Lumenline Plus" tier is on track for an October launch. Pricing lands between our basic and enterprise plans, and early pilot feedback from the Fenmoor cohort has been encouraging. Marketing wants six weeks of runway, so we'll lock the feature set by mid-August. Before you weigh in, please read the confidential rationale below.

management briefing: The renewal with Zoraelax Group closes at $10 million a year, 15 percent below the last contract. Project Ralael slips by six weeks because of the audit delay.

## Tuning the Parcelwing Webhook

The Parcelwing dispatcher retries failed webhook deliveries with exponential backoff and a jitter window to avoid thundering-herd effects on carrier endpoints. Reviewers should verify that any change to these values keeps total retry duration under the contractual delivery SLA, and that the queue depth alarm thresholds are adjusted to match. The current defaults are listed here.

tuning table, yajog-yahof:
BUDGETS = {
    "lamvan": 303,
    "wenox": 460,
    "fenvan": 525,
}

**Q: Why does MatchCore stall for a few hundred milliseconds sometimes?**

GC pauses. MatchCore keeps large in-memory candidate pools, and old-gen collections pause the matcher. Mitigations: pool pre-sizing, tuned heap flags, and sharding hot queues. Don't change GC flags without benchmarking on the Quillridge staging cluster first. Tuning history and current flag rationale are on the internal page below.

operations page: https://jenkins.zemvarcloud.local/job/merge_requests/repo/build/73930b4b30f0a8ed